Right now, the ability to generate donation letters is unavailable in QuickBooks Online (QBO). As a workaround, you can create a transaction statement or pulling up the Sales by Donor Detail report to get the details you need per donor.
Here's how to create a statement:
Click + New from the left menu.
Select Statement under Other.
Choose Transaction Statement as the Statement Type.
Set your desired period and choose the recipients.
Select Print or Preview at the bottom or select Save and close when you're done.
To create the Sales by Donor Detail report, refer to the steps below:
Click Reports on the left panel.
Type Sales by Customer Detail on the search box.
Click the Customize button in the upper right-hand corner.
Maximize the Rows/Columns section, and then click the Change columns link.
Check the box for Donors.
Click Run report.

I am trying to run statements as noted above to use for donor letters. However, my system is telling me that only 6 of my 75 donors have statements. I don't understand why??
Thanks for joining the thread and providing information about your concern, bg73.
Let me share information with you about creating donor statements. There are things that you need to consider when creating. These are the following:
For Balance Forward and Transaction statement types, ensure that the Start Date and End Date chosen coincides with the corresponding Invoice/Pledge dates.
The customer needs to have at least 1 Open/Overdue Pledge/Invoice so that the system could generate a statement.
For Balance Forward statement type, check if the Donor/Customer Balance Status matches the Status of the Pledge/Invoice, i.e. Open/Overdue/All.
If a donor does not have an email address within the Donor Information setting, they will appear under the Missing email address tab.
